The organizing committee for AGF, the largest animation and game festival in Korea, has released an official digest video capturing the vibrant atmosphere of 'AGF 2025,' which was held last year on the largest scale in the event's history.
This digest video condenses the three days of 'AGF 2025,' held from Friday, December 5 to Sunday, December 7 at KINTEX Exhibition Center 1 in Ilsan, into a single feature. It captures the non-stop energy of the festival, showcasing booths filling Halls 1 through 5, experiential content that brought popular IP worlds to life, pop-up stores featuring limited-edition merchandise, the iconic cosplay scene, and the RED and BLUE stages, which hosted voice actor talk shows and mini-live performances. The video brings the cheers of the 100k attendees who packed KINTEX directly to the screen.
Domestic subculture fandoms no longer stop at simply consuming works. As global hits like 'Attack on Titan,' 'Demon Slayer,' 'Chainsaw Man,' and the 'Solo Leveling' series continue to expand their fan bases in Korea, consumption has evolved beyond viewing to include 'open runs' for limited-edition goods, cross-regional shopping trips, and visiting spaces that recreate the worlds of these works. With the increase in offline touchpoints like pop-up stores, the way fans enjoy content has shifted from sitting in front of a monitor to seeing, touching, and participating in person. In gaming, too, the culture of sharing the experience on-site with others who love the same IP is growing beyond the solitary play experience.
'AGF' stands at the center of this shift. Fans can walk through the worlds of their favorite works in large-scale booths that bring game and animation spaces to life, and meet voice actors and virtual creators they previously only saw on screens. Stage programs, where artists and the audience interact, transform content once enjoyed alone into a shared experience. The ability to gather these scattered offline experiences into one place over three days is why 'AGF' is in the spotlight.
As a result, 'AGF' surpassed 100k official attendees (100518) for the first time last year, marking a record-breaking growth of approximately 40% compared to the previous year. With major domestic and international game companies and globally popular IPs participating in large numbers, the event took a leap forward in both scale and lineup. Having established itself as a venue where fans and brands meet directly, 'AGF' is leading the expansion of related events and contributing to the growth of the domestic subculture festival market.
